I’m certainly in the 3 branches being trouble category.

 

My real issue is that I am very concerned about the quality of the CDT especially as it’s popularity continues to rise. Rushing a release out in 6 months is very difficult for even commercial development and basically means you have to hit the ground running now. And with vacations coming up in the summer, I just think it is unrealistic to expect a commercial quality CDT release at year end with any significant feature content. Been there, tried that, didn’t work out. Anyone remember CDT 2.0 and the 2.0.1 and 2.0.2 that followed quickly after and 2.1 that didn’t really have any content.

 

We wait a year for new Platform features. I’d like to think that the CDT has reached that level of maturity now as well.
